#567992 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#567992 is composed of 33.7% red, 47.5%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.1% cyan, 17.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 205 degrees, a saturation of 25.9% and a lightness of 45.5%. #567992 color hex could be obtained by blending #acf2ff with #000025.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#567992 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#567992 has RGB values of R:86, G:121,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0.17, Y:0,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 5667218.

Shades and Tints of #567992
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06080a is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.
